One of the most popular applications of virtual reality is through the use of VR headsets.Math had been identified as a priority area because students' overall scores in mathematics were significantly lower than those in reading. In 2014, to address this issue, Cochran piloted the use of virtual reality with some students in math classes. Furthermore, it allowsMixed-reality technology is a powerful tool used in healthcare and medical education to engage students in life-like scenarios. This blend of virtual and augmented reality images incorporates virtual projections with the real environment to allow real-time observation and interaction [1]. By exploring immersive learning environments such as visiting Oct 19, 2023 · In traditional basic life support training for university students or the public, trainees practice simulations only once or twice during the course, potentially limiting their competence. In contrast, virtual reality allows trainees to independently study and practice as often as needed, enhancing their skills.
